Abstract

This study addresses the gap in customized educational tools for enhanced student engagement by integrating local content into digital learning resources. An E-Book tailored for eleventh-grade students at one of the high schools at Palangka Raya city was developed, focusing on narrative texts that incorporate local contexts. Utilizing the Technological Pedagogical Content Knowledge (TPACK) framework and the ADDIE model within a Research & Development approach, the project aimed to advance the learning experience through digital innovation. Expert validation indicated high-quality media presentation and local content integration, with scores of 78% and 88%, respectively. Student feedback revealed a remarkable attractiveness rating of 90%. These findings suggest that the E-Book significantly enhances educational outcomes, demonstrating the efficacy of the TPACK framework and ADDIE model in creating relevant learning experiences. The study underscores the importance of local content in digital educational tools and has broad implications for curriculum development.
